Listed below are pulse rates​ (beats per​ minute) from samples of adult males and females. Find the mean and median for each of the two samples and then compare the two sets of results. Does there appear to be a​ difference?

Solution:

Let the missing data be



Mean of male=Xˉ=67+54+...+6915=66.133=\bar X=\dfrac{67+54+...+69}{15}=66.133

Arranging in descending order: 88, 86, 77, 76, 69, 67, 64, 63, 62, 61, 59, 57, 55, 54, 54

Median = (n+1)/2 th term = 8 th term = 63

Mean of female=Yˉ=90+79+...+7415=81.066=\bar Y=\dfrac{90+79+...+74}{15}=81.066

Arranging in descending order: 93, 90, 89, 89, 88, 87,87, 87, 84, 79, 74, 72, 68, 66,63.

Median = (n+1)/2 th term = 8 th term = 87


The mean and median for males are lower than that of females.

Thus, the pulse rate for females appear to be higher than males.
